I have a multisearch to view data for yesterday only.

[search
 index=... earliest = -1d@d latest=+0d@d| search ....
]
[search
index=... earliest = -1d@d latest=+0d@d|search ...] |timechart span=30m count BY cat

Running separately the time window is correct, it gives me data for yesterday BUT when running it as a multisearch it gives data for yesterday BUT the x-axis is extended to the current time without any data. I don't want the x-axis to be extended up to the current time.
